I'm trying to make a doorbell with raspberry pi, home assistant and telegram however i keep getting this error when trying to add parts to configurations.yaml.
Jul 14 15:49:19 homeassistant hass[9133]: 2020-07-14 15:49:18 ERROR (MainThread) [homeassistant.bootstrap] Failed to parse configuration.yaml: mapping values are not allowed here Jul 14 15:49:19 homeassistant hass[9133]: in "/home/pi/.homeassistant/configuration.yaml", line 23, column 12. Activating safe mode
Here is my configuration file.
...ANSWER
Answered 2020-Jul-14 at 15:51It's because trigger:
and action:
are more indented than alias:
. They need to be on the same indentation level.
When trigger:
is more indented than alias:
, it is read as part of the scalar value of alias
, effectively making the value of that scalar Doorbell_pressed_automation\ntrigger
. However, multiline scalars, while allowed, must not be used as implicit mapping keys. Hence, when the mapping value starts after the :
of trigger
, you get the error that mapping values are not allowed here.
